Château Mouton Rothschild

Pauillac Red Bordeaux Blend 1945

Tasted blind. Ruby color. Almost opaque. Young fruit forward nose. Notes of plums, mocha, dark chocolate, coffee, cinnamon and some exotic thing like eucalyptus. So rich and vibrant in the mouth. A forever finish. This wine took us in all directions. Immortal. Stan's 60th will always be remembered for the 45 Latour vs 45 Mouton mano y mano battle. A wine life moment for sure. — 8 years ago

Château Cos d'Estournel

Saint-Estèphe Red Bordeaux Blend 1966

Another trip around the sun, another “66 Bordeaux. This time it was the Cos d’Estournel. Clearly the best of the “66 vintage I have tasted over the last several years on my birthday. It started with salami and spice on the nose. Mid palate it morphed into this lovely soft earthy red fruit and finished with leather and spice. No hint of the typical Cos pencil lead. This wine still had depth and character. I was surprised by the richness and depth of color. It started to fade after about 45 minutes but wow, were those minutes an amazing wine experience. — 5 years ago

Tenuta Caparzo

Brunello di Montalcino Sangiovese 2014

The name of the estate comes from "Ca' Pazzo", shown on ancient maps. Estate covers an area of 190 hectares, 54 which are vineyards, 4 are olive groves, 87 which are wooded and 45 are planted with new vines. Deep Ruby with a berry fruit aromas blossom and smoke, aged for 2 years on oak. On the palate cherry & strawberry flavors, with leather, cacao and tobacco notes. Lively acidity, fine approachable tannins, long ending with spicy oak finish. — 5 years ago
